Steelers GM Khan to Attend Ohio State Pro Day as Draft Buzz Grows

Steelers general manager Omar Khan is expected to attend Ohio State's Pro Day, with coordinators Brian Angelichio and Patrick Graham also on site, as Pittsburgh continues its Pro Day scouting ahead of the draft. Ohio State is home to several projected first‑rounders the Steelers could target, including Sonny Styles, Caleb Downs, Carnell Tate and Kayden McDonald, among others. Khan’s appearance follows a Georgia Pro Day stop, and OSU staff ties (notably former Steelers coach Arthur Smith now OSU's OC) add intrigue around potential trades or selections, though McCarthy’s attendance remains uncertain.

Steelers Reignite Comp-Pick Strategy to Boost 2027 Draft Capital

The Steelers are again pursuing the compensatory-pick strategy in 2025 free agency, using trades and non-compensatory signings to maximize 2027 draft value. Early moves include trading for Pittman Jr., reworking Jamel Dean’s contract to avoid comp counts, and noting departures like Kenneth Gainwell and James Pierre, with Isaac Seumalo potentially adding a fifth-round comp. If this repeats, it could steadily feed more draft capital.

Khan Promises Flexibility Over Fixes for Steelers’ 2026 Plan

At the Steelers’ 2026 media day, GM Omar Khan stressed flexibility over sweeping changes, signaling that no drastic roster purge is planned even as he keeps options open with top players. He offered guarded updates: Broderick Jones’ neck injury is significant with no clear timetable; Jones’ return and Kaleb Johnson’s rookie year status remain murky; Darnell Washington’s broken arm won’t derail plans and DeShon Elliott is on schedule; fifth-year option for Jones likely declined with Dylan Cook in the left‑tackle mix. On Aaron Rodgers, he acknowledged no hard deadline but expects a decision sooner than later. He also avoided firm guarantees on veterans like Patrick Queen and Jalen Ramsey while stressing cap space could support unconventional moves (extensions for multiple tight ends or extra edge rushers). Overall, Khan’s tone kept the Steelers flexible rather than predictive.

Steelers signal sweeping coaching shake-up as emails go dark for staff

Omar Khan and Art Rooney II told Steelers coaches that their emails would be shut off after the week and to start exploring other jobs, signaling a broad overhaul as a new head coach likely takes the reins; one coach, Danny Smith, has already departed for Tampa Bay and many assistants face uncertain futures depending on the next hire.

Glazer: Steelers Must Open Up Spending to Stay Relevant After Tomlin

NFL insider Jay Glazer says the Steelers must overhaul their organizational approach and spending in the post-Tomlin era to stay relevant, criticizing a culture of conservatism and reliance on stability. He notes recent bold moves—trading for DK Metcalf and the Minkah Fitzpatrick–Jalen Ramsey transactions—as evidence the team can change, and argues that opening up to outside spending is necessary, a shift GM Omar Khan has begun to push, even as the Steelers navigate a quarterback and aging defense.

"2024 Pittsburgh Steelers Free Agency Forecast and Predictions"

The Pittsburgh Steelers, with a significant increase in the salary cap and the release of veterans, are expected to be more active in the 2024 free agency under general manager Omar Khan. While the team has needs at inside linebacker, cornerback, offensive line, safety, and quarterback, it's unlikely they pursue a big-name quarterback in free agency. The team may consider re-signing Mason Rudolph or pursue former Titans quarterback Ryan Tannehill. The Steelers will also need to make moves to free up cap space and address needs in the secondary and offensive line.

"Steelers GM Omar Khan Expresses Full Faith in QB Kenny Pickett Amid Competition"

Pittsburgh Steelers General Manager Omar Khan expressed confidence in quarterback Kenny Pickett but emphasized the team's intention to explore all options to improve the quarterbacks room, including draft, free agency, and trade market. Khan highlighted the impact of new offensive coordinator Arthur Smith on Pickett and acknowledged the likelihood of strong competition at the quarterback position, potentially involving Mason Rudolph or another veteran, as the team prepares for the upcoming season.

"Steelers GM Omar Khan Delays Combine Press Conference, Anticipates Key Storylines and Positions to Watch"

Pittsburgh Steelers GM Omar Khan's scheduled press conference at the 2024 NFL Combine has been postponed due to a family emergency. It's uncertain when or if Khan will address the media later in the week, but Steelers Depot members will continue to gather information about the team's meetings and top prospects at the combine. Topics Khan was likely going to discuss included the team's quarterback outlook, draft class overview, addressing the hole at center, and the future of DB Patrick Peterson.
